added settings Page and components

This commit is contained in:
2023-12-06 11:51:42 +01:00
parent 45c651e853
commit 6a4a799c85
21 changed files with 1301 additions and 99 deletions

View File

@ -25,15 +25,15 @@
</router-link>
</div>
<div id="content-body">
<ClientSearch />
<ProductionOrdersTemplateTable />
<ProductionOrdersTemplateTableNoClient />
<ProductionOrdersTemplate />
<TemplateChecklist />
<TemplateSearch />
<ProductionOrdersInstanceTable />
<ProductionOrdersInstance />
<InstanceChecklist />
<ClientSearch v-if="onTemplatelist || onCustomerTemplatelist"/>
<ProductionOrdersTemplateTable v-if="onTemplatelist"/>
<ProductionOrdersTemplateTableNoClient v-if="onCustomerTemplatelist"/>
<ProductionOrdersTemplate v-if="onTemplate"/>
<TemplateChecklist v-if="onTemplate"/>
<TemplateSearch v-if="onInstancelist"/>
<ProductionOrdersInstanceTable v-if="onInstancelist"/>
<ProductionOrdersInstance v-if="onInstance"/>
<InstanceChecklist v-if="onInstance"/>
</div>
</section>
</template>
@ -57,6 +57,13 @@ definePageMeta({
})
const darkMode = ref(true)
// to render the right components
const onTemplatelist = ref(true)
const onCustomerTemplatelist = ref(false)
const onTemplate = ref(false)
const onInstancelist = ref(false)
const onInstance = ref(false)
</script>
<script>